Description
【発明の詳細な説明】
本発明は精紡機、撚糸機等に使用される紡機用
トラベラに関するものである。D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a spinning machine traveler used in spinning machines, yarn twisting machines, and the like.
従来、紡機用トラベラとして金属製トラベラが
あるが、最近の高生産性をめざした高速回転、高
速紡出のもとでは、リング、トラベラ間の摩擦が
激しく、トラベラが急激に摩耗して寿命が短くな
つたり、トラベラ焼けによるトラベラ飛散が発生
し、糸切れの原因となつていた。このため、トラ
ベラの耐摩耗性を向上するためトラベラにクロム
メツキを施したものが考えられたがクロムメツキ
は硬度が非常に高いが、リングとのなじみ性が悪
く、紡出初期において紡出張力が非常に高くな
り、糸のつつぱりによる糸切れが多発するという
欠点があり、しかも、メツキ表面に亀裂が入りや
すく、これが剥離摩耗の原因となり、トラベラの
異常摩耗を来たすという欠点があつた。 Conventionally, metal travelers have been used for spinning machines, but with the recent high-speed rotation and high-speed spinning aimed at high productivity, the friction between the ring and the traveler is intense, causing rapid wear of the traveler and shortening its lifespan. This caused the thread to become short and the traveler to be scattered due to traveler burn, leading to thread breakage. Therefore, in order to improve the wear resistance of the traveler, it was considered that the traveler was coated with chrome plating, but although chrome plating has very high hardness, it did not fit well with the ring, and the spinning force was extremely high in the early stage of spinning. This has the disadvantage that the threads become more expensive and breakage occurs frequently due to thread plucking.Furthermore, the plating surface tends to crack, which causes exfoliation and wear, resulting in abnormal wear of the traveler.
本発明は上記従来の欠点を解消する紡機用トラ
ベラを提供するものであり、以下、本発明の1実
施例を図面に基づいて説明する。 The present invention provides a traveler for a spinning machine that eliminates the above-mentioned conventional drawbacks, and one embodiment of the present invention will be described below with reference to the drawings.
実施例
本発明の紡機用トラベラの1実施例を第1図、
第2図に示す。Embodiment FIG. 1 shows an embodiment of a traveler for a spinning machine according to the present invention.
Shown in Figure 2.
図に示すように、横型の金属トラベラ1の内面
2を含む全面にFeを25重量パーセント含む、Ni
―Fe合金メツキ層3を厚さが10μとなるように形
成して紡機用トラベラを構成する。 As shown in the figure, the entire surface including the inner surface 2 of a horizontal metal traveler 1 is made of Ni containing 25% by weight of Fe.
- A traveler for a spinning machine is constructed by forming the Fe alloy plating layer 3 to a thickness of 10μ.
上記実施例において被覆層の厚みは1μ〜20μが
紡機用トラベラとして最適である。すなわち、
1μ未満の厚さでは使用初期において摩耗により
なくなつてしまい、寿命が短くなり、20μを越え
る厚さではリングとトラベラ間あるいは、糸とト
ラベラ間の摺接により剥離摩耗を起しやすく、異
常摩耗の原因となる。 In the above embodiments, the thickness of the coating layer is 1 μ to 20 μ, which is optimal for a traveler for a spinning machine. That is,
If the thickness is less than 1μ, it will wear out due to wear in the early stages of use, resulting in a shortened service life.If the thickness exceeds 20μ, peeling and wear may occur due to sliding contact between the ring and the traveler, or between the thread and the traveler, resulting in abnormal wear. It causes.
また5〜40%の鉄をニツケルと共析させること
ができる。 In addition, 5 to 40% iron can be eutectoid with nickel.
本発明の紡機用トラベラは、金属トラベラの少
くともリングと接触する内面に、Ni―Fe合金メ
ツキを施したため、トラベラの使用初期において
特に、上記Ni―Fe合金がリングとトラベラの間
に良好なる潤滑剤層を形成し、これによりトラベ
ラのリングに対する初期なじみを向上させ、糸切
れ、トラベラ焼けを大巾に減少させる。 In the spinning machine traveler of the present invention, at least the inner surface of the metal traveler that comes into contact with the ring is plated with Ni-Fe alloy, so that the Ni-Fe alloy has a good relationship between the ring and the traveler, especially in the early stages of use of the traveler. Forms a lubricant layer, which improves the initial conformity of the traveler to the ring and greatly reduces thread breakage and traveler burn.
また、トラベラとリング間の摩耗抵抗を減少さ
せ、また、延性も大きためメツキの割れや剥離も
少く、第3図に示すように従来のニツケルメツキ
トラベラAに比べ摩耗量を著しく減少し、トラベ
ラの寿命も大巾に延長することができ、しかも廉
価であるなど優れた効果を有する発明である。 In addition, the wear resistance between the traveler and the ring is reduced, and the ductility is high, so there is less cracking or peeling of the plating, and as shown in Figure 3, the amount of wear is significantly reduced compared to the conventional Nickel plating Traveler A. This invention has excellent effects such as being able to greatly extend the life of the machine and being inexpensive.
第1図は本発明の紡機用トラベラの1実施例を
示す一部切欠き正面図、第2図は第1図における
A―A′線断面図第3図は本発明と従来トラベラ
の特性の比較を示す曲線図である。
1…トラベラ、2…内面、3…Ni―Fe合金メ
ツキ層。
Fig. 1 is a partially cutaway front view showing one embodiment of a traveler for a spinning machine according to the present invention, Fig. 2 is a sectional view taken along the line A-A' in Fig. 1, and Fig. 3 shows characteristics of the present invention and a conventional traveler. It is a curve diagram showing a comparison. 1... Traveler, 2... Inner surface, 3... Ni-Fe alloy plating layer.
Claims (1)
内面に、Ni―Fe合金層を厚さ1μ〜20μに形成した
ことを特徴とする紡機用トラベラ。1. A traveler for a spinning machine, characterized in that a Ni-Fe alloy layer is formed to a thickness of 1 μm to 20 μm on at least the inner surface of the metal traveler that contacts the ring.
